Firstly , I start with fresh brows which have been groomed with a spooley. I am wearing a coverage of foundation and powder but as I'm only showing you what I do to my brows - I won't go in great detail. 

Secondly , I used black eyeshadow to fill in my brows . You can use any pencil or gel or anything else that works for you. I used the black in the ' what are you waiting for?'  palette because I believe this has the closest match to my eyebrows as other brands that I have tried has not worked for me . 
Do you guys have any recommendations for dark brown eyebrows ? 
Then I used the Mac concealer and a real techniques angled brow brush to draw around my brow so I can create defined brows. I prefer to go for a natural HD brow with ombré at the front of the brow.
Then I used a triangle foundation brush because I feel that the material and the angle can help to get tricky parts that blend in with my brows . This brush is really clever to make sure it doesn't ruin the shape but also gives it a great coverage . The technique I create is too blend from the line drawn with concealer down and to not leave any marks at all. 

Then you have the final result !! I like to put foundation over the concealer to make matte as possible .
